The real photo postcards posted in this thread have been amazing, but I kind of think they don't really fit within the spirit of a "1 of 1 card" as I'm viewing it. I do consider them cards, or close enough to cards. And I'm glad they've been posted. But so many real photo postcards are unique examples. A real photo postcard that's a 1 of 1 isn't particularly rare, even though that particular example might be, if that makes sense. But a 1 of 1 for a card that is part of an issue where numerous examples were likely produced and distributed is quite rare, in my opinion. I'm definitely not trying to take anything away from the RPPCs that have been posted here because there are several of them I would love to own. I hope some of that makes sense because it doesn't feel like I'm doing a good job of explaining myself. Also, like Leon, I prefer to say "only known example" instead of 1 of 1.
